> - *Discussion with ICANN Finance on the Draft FY19 ICANN Operating
> Plan and Budget*Xavier Calvez the ICANN CFO made presentation giving
> update about the FY19 budget ongoing process as the public comments period
> ended few days ago prior to Puerto Rico meeting. He also presented the
> proposals about the replenishment of reserve fund (a public comment is
> ongoing on the matter) and responsed to council questions.
>
>
> As a follow-up, the council standing committee on budget and
> operations (SCBO) was tasked to help on facilitating the collection and
> channelling of any Council questions or comments for ICANN Finance. It will
> also develop the Council input concerning Reserve Fund replenishment
> strategy (there was no objection to move forward)

> - *Discussion on Updated Charter for the Cross Community Engagement
> Group on Internet Governance (CCWG-IG)*
>
> The discussion regarding the new vehicle (Cross-Community Engagment Group)
> to replace the CCWG-IG continued from the last council call and the floor
> was opened to get questions from councillors. Some asked for clarification
> about the level of resources expected to be allocated to the Cross
> Community Engagement Group on Internet Governance but also about the
> expenditures related to IG activities of ICANN (which is beyond CCWG-IG
> remit).
>
>
> Per resolution <https://gnso.icann.org/en/council/resolutions#201708> voted
> in last August <https://gnso.icann.org/en/council/resolutions#201708>,
> the GNSO is no longer a Chartering Organization of the CCWG-IG and the
> discussion will continue with regard joining the new vehicle or not. The
> GNSO council tasked the liaison to ccNSO and CCWG-IG to liaise with ccNSO to
> resolve concerns identified by the ccNSO Council. The withdrawal doesn't
> impact the CCWG-IG activities and the WG is still active.

> - *Discussion on the GNSO Council’s input to the consultation on the
> Fellowship Program*
>
> A consultation on fellowship program was initiated by ICANN seeking input
> from the different SO/AC. The council tasked a small group of councilors
> to work on response from GNSO council perspective to add metrics and
> setting realistic expectations from the program. A strawperson/draft
> comment was presented during the meeting to seek feedback from council. The
> group will work and circulate an updated version taking into account the
> comments received from the councillors,

> - *Review of the Inter-Registrar Transfer Policy (IRTP)*
>
> GDD as responsible of policy implemention sent a letter
> <https://gnso.icann.org/en/drafts/irtp-to-gnso-council-28feb18-en.pdf> to
> the GNSO Council, noting that the updated IRTP went into effect on 1
> December 2016 and therefore, the policy was in place for over 12 months and
> so possible review. It suggested that a Post-Implementation IRTP Status
> Report be drafted and published for public comment. The report and a
> summary of public comment would be provided to the GNSO Council by end of
> May.
>
>
> GNSO Council is planning to consider next steps, timing and provide
> guidance to ICANN on if, how, and when the review of the Inter-Registrar
> Transfer Policy (IRTP) should take place, taking into account the ongoing
> discussion on the post-implementation policy review framework as well as
> the transfer issue that is being considered by the Privacy & Proxy Services
> Accreditation Issues Implementation Review Team.

> - *Customer Standing Committee and IANA Functions Reviews*
>
> With regard to IANA functions, there will be soon 2 planned reviews on
> Customer Standing Committee and the IANA Functions . As there is risk of
> overlap, a small team was tasked to make proposals to avoid the overlap and
> coordinate with ccNSO on the matter.
>
>
> - *Board request regarding Emojis*
>
> Council received a board request regarding Emojis in domain names (For
> more details, https://www.icann.org/resources/board-material/resolutions-
> 2017-11-02-en#1.e). As first action, the council will send response to
> acknowledge the receipt. There was discussion about the issue as request
> was not clear for thee council.
> The Staff was tasked to summarize Board resolution and SSAC Advice for
> small team of councilors to consider. Then that small team will liaise
> with the SSAC and ccNSO to respond to Board resolution.

> - *Council liaison to new gTLD Subsequent Procedures WG*
>
> The council continued the task to appoint or reappoint new liaisons to PDP
> WGs. It was decided to have 2 councillors serving jointly as liaisons to the
> New gTLD Subsequent Procedures PDP WG as it has several working tracks (5)
> and may be difficult for one person to cover all (attending the plenaries
> and WTs calls in weekly basis).
>
>
> - *Subsequent Procedures PDP /Right Protections Mechanisms
> Consolidated timeline*
>
> As follow-up of sunday session, the council discussed the New gTLD
> Subsequent Procedures PDP and Rights Protection Mechanisms WG timelines as
> there may be some dependencies between the 2 PDPs and so possible impact
> about the delivery of the recommendations and implementation.
>
>
> The Council liaisons to the respective PDP WGs were tasked to review
> Sunday Working Session and extract notes and action items and then work
> with PDP WG leadership to expand timeline to include potential
> implementation steps/scenarios.

> - *PDP 3.0*
>
> As follow-up of the GNSO council strategical meeting in January and
> discussion about PDP improvement, the GNSO leadership took the initiative
> to make changes to the usual Sunday working session agenda and allocated
> the whole morning to discuss the improvement of PDP, inviting WGs
> leaderships to give their input about issues. There was brainstorming
> exercise to explore solutions to the different identified issues.
>
>
> In order to keep the momentum, the council tasked staff to consolidate
> input and comments into a Google document and also to propose next steps
> (e.g., identify goal for ICANN62 and plan backwards). Later on, the council
> will consider whether to form a small team to help in addressing the
> previous actions.

> - *Board Process for GAC Advice*
>
> A concern was raised regarding the description of board process for GAC
> advice in the process documentation project (https://www.icann.org/process
> documentation) as it is not capturing accurately the input from GNSO.
> Council decided that comments can be sent to staff to be shared to those
> managing the relevant documentation and so giving input on those
> documentation as they may be used by community members without refering to
> the original accurate documents.
